India Sees Decline in TB Incidence and Mortality

  • 03 Apr 2024

India's efforts lead to 16% decrease in TB cases and 18% drop in TB-related deaths since 2015, according to a recent India TB report 2024.

Key Points

  • Incidence and Mortality Reduction: TB incidence rate decreases from 237 to 199 per lakh population, mortality rate declines from 28 to 23 per lakh population from 2015 to 2022.
  • Increase in Private Sector Notifications: Private healthcare sector notifies 32% of TB cases in 2023, up by 17% from the previous year.
  • State-wise Notification Improvements: Uttar Pradesh and Bihar witness significant increases in TB case notifications.
  • Post-COVID Efforts: National Tuberculosis Elimination Programme accelerates efforts post-COVID, focusing on free diagnostic services and financial support for patients.
  • Support Network: Over 1.5 lakh Nikshay Mitras provide assistance to persons affected by TB, while DBT under Nikshay Poshan Yojana disburses financial aid to beneficiaries.
